Tigo Tanzania has been named among the top global socially devoted brands on Facebook in a report issued by SocialBakers on the 7 February 2013, covering a study on the world's top 10 socially devoted brands on Facebook in the last quarter of 2012. Tigo Tanzania is the only telecom company from central, eastern and southern Africa in the ranking among some of the world's biggest brands.

The AccessKenya group announced this week that it has completed full automation of its customer service through the acquisition and integration of the Internet Protocol Contact Manager (IPCM) and HEAT system from the US-based Frontrange Systems. The two systems have further been integrated with the new AVAYA PBX.

12 Jul 2010 12:35[Published by Ovum, part of the Datamonitor group] GLOBAL: Call centre spending on speech analytics is set to double worldwide, growing from around US$95 million in 2009 to US$180 million (about R720 million to about R1.36 billion, respectively) by 2014 according to Ovum.
